Output 5e59e5dcf7a8517654bbab313f89b10e817bd33ac716f4e52d0b569052dce879:1

value
1668870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f44aa845aabbd870ac91777c06b0f57464cd05e OP_EQUAL
address
37TYkdccfTJwNJYhvqGsnQjnuZAJie7dB9
transaction
5e59e5dcf7a8517654bbab313f89b10e817bd33ac716f4e52d0b569052dce879
confirmations
292460
spent
true